Where Do Online Students at Colorado Northwestern Community College Come From?

Geographic distribution of students enrolled exclusively in online courses (Fall 2024 census)

Exclusively Online
140
of 1,271 total (11%)
Some Online Courses
290
of 1,271 total (22.8%)

Where exclusively-online students are located

Same state (CO) 129 (92.1%)
Other US states 11 (7.9%)
ℹ️

About this data: The geographic breakdown above uses IPEDS Fall Enrollment census data, which captures a single-day snapshot. The enrollment figures in the "How Do Students Learn?" section above use 12-month unduplicated headcount, which typically shows higher numbers as it covers the full academic year. Both are official IPEDS data — they measure different things.

92% of Colorado Northwestern Community College's exclusively online students are located in CO. The school primarily serves local online learners.

How Intensively Do Students Study at Colorado Northwestern Community College?

Student Enrollment Intensity

The Full-Time Equivalent (FTE) ratio shows the average course load intensity. An FTE ratio of 1.0 means all students attend full-time, while lower values indicate more part-time enrollment.

56.6%
FTE Ratio
Intensity LevelModerate-Low

Significant part-time enrollment, ideal for working professionals and students with other responsibilities.

Undergraduate FTE
720
Total FTE
720
Headcount
1,271

FTE represents student enrollment adjusted for course load. Two half-time students equal 1 FTE.
